Participants
The participants were 18 2-year-old children (M = 29.8 months; 7 girls) and 40 adults. All children
were monolingual English speakers and recruited from local day-care centers and preschools. Children
at this point in development were chosen based on research demonstrating that children begin to
develop a shape bias at around 24 months of age (e.g., Gershkoff-Stowe & Smith, 2004; Landau
et al., 1988). Adult participants were undergraduate students recruited from the department’s subject
pool. Adult participants received course credit for their participation
